Babbitt Kawasaki '09 Arenacross Lineup

Tuesday, December 16, 2008
Monster Energy Kawasaki
After coming up just short of the 2008 AMA Arenacross Series Championship with rider Kelly Smith, Babbitt’s Monster Energy Kawasaki returns in 2009 with one of the most talented pairs the series has ever seen.

Seasoned veteran Smith returns this season, but new to the stable is the defending series champion and two-time title holder Chad Johnson. Team owner Eddie Babbitt’s has been known for putting the best talent on his bikes and in 2009 it won’t be any different.

“We couldn’t ask for anything better for this season,” said Team Manager Denny Bartz. “Kelly is one of the most experienced riders in the field and Chad has proven he knows what it takes to get the job done. Hopefully, these two do what they did last season and put on a show for the crowd and give Babbitt’s a 1-2 finish.”

Smith, from Ludington, Mich., has raced professionally since 1998. He has been a part of both AMA Motocross and AMA Supercross, but appears to have found a home in the AMA Arenacross Series with one of the most successful teams on the circuit.

Johnson, from Rhienlander, Wis., has won two of the last three AMA Arenacross Series titles. A full time arenacross competitor since 2001, he has arguably logged more laps on the challenging, technical layouts than any of his competitors.

Based out of Grand Rapids, Mich., Babbitt’s Monster Energy Kawasaki has the fortune of kicking off the 2009 season in their backyard at Van Andel Arena, January 2-4. With that incentive, fans can count on seeing the green duo up front as they fight for their spot on the podium in front of family and friends.
